"Winter" is an etching by Swedish artist Johann Esaias Nilson, completed between 1731 and 1788, before his death in that year. This artwork is part of a series of etchings, each depicting one of the four seasons, and features a romantic scene of a couple ice skating. The etching is surrounded by a delicate border of swirling branches, creating a sense of depth and movement. It is currently housed in the Rijksmuseum in Amsterdam.
